Medical Cannabis: A Growing Remedy Across Europe

Medical cannabis remains to be a subject of increasing interest across Europe. While legal laws vary significantly from country to country, many nations are adopting the therapeutic potential of cannabis for a range of medical conditions.

From chronic pain and anxiety to epilepsy and multiple sclerosis, patients are reporting significant relief from cannabis-based treatments. This growing understanding is fueled by increasing scientific evidence highlighting the effectiveness of cannabis in managing certain ailments. Nevertheless, challenges remain in terms of standardization, access, and public perception. The European Union's stance on medical cannabis remains fragmented, with some countries championing the cause while others remain cautious. Nonetheless, the future of medical cannabis in Europe appears bright, with ongoing research and a increasing demand from patients likely to shape its trajectory in the years to come.
